Cream cheese muffins!
8:30 am 3 Cream cheese muffins. I need to do a whole separate post about these egg diet menu plan cream cheese muffins because I have learned some tips and tricks. For now, here is the quick & dirty: Melt 4 ounces cream cheese and 4 tbsp butter on medium heat in a glass measuring cup in the microwave until soft. (Mine took a couple minutes at 50% power). Using a whisk, whip a pinch of vanilla powder, a dash of cinnamon, 4 eggs and the equivalent of 2 teaspoons sweetener into the glass measuring cup. Pour batter into 6 muffin tins. Bake at 325 for about 45 minutes. (I use silicone muffin tins because no cooking spray required)
Egg Diet Menu plan- devilled eggs 12:30 pm – Devilled Eggs. 3 eggs cut in half. Remove yolks and mash with 2 tbsp mayo. Salt and pepper. Easy, easy.
5:30 pm. Grilled Cheese Wafflewich. Oh, this is sooo delicious! If you recall, I made a double batch of egg diet plan waffles last night and saved 4 waffles for today. I buy the sliced cheddar from Costco (each slice is about 3/4 ounce) and this is NOT those processed cheese slices. I measured out my tablespoon of butter and put half in my green non-stick frying pan. Put the cheese slice between 2 waffles and slap it down in the pan. I press it into the sizzling butter until browned, and then flip it over until I can see the cheese is melting. Repeat this with the other 2 waffles, butter and another slice of cheese. Enjoy!
